🎤 Maestro ACC-MIC-GM3 Installation Harness for Chevy, Buick & GMC
The Maestro ACC-MIC-GM3 Installation Harness supports the ADS-MIC1 microphone retention interface in select Chevy, Buick, and GMC vehicles.
It provides vehicle-specific connections for retaining a compatible factory microphone during an aftermarket radio installation.
This accessory helps maintain organized wiring while reducing unnecessary modifications to supported factory connections.

❓ Frequently Asked Questions
1. What does the ACC-MIC-GM3 do?
It provides compatible wiring for ADS-MIC1 factory microphone retention installations in select GM vehicles.
2. Which vehicle brands are supported?
It is designed for select compatible Chevrolet, Buick, and GMC vehicle applications.
3. Does this harness replace the ADS-MIC1?
No. It works with the compatible ADS-MIC1 interface to support factory microphone retention.
